A Personal Statement

I have always desired to be an instrument of positive change in the world, particularly in the lives of people and other beings who are hurting…who are lonely or poor or oppressed or repressed…as well as the Earth as a whole. Over the years of my professional life, friends and colleagues have helped me discern gifts for leading, strategizing, and communicating which I have used to embolden various sorts of healers, helpers, justice-makers, and counselors.

The consultant-client relationship often becomes a close one and that is not surprising. In most successful consultations, the effort begins with some sense of vulnerability on both sides but then develops into a happy, collaborative and fruitful partnership. Consequently, mutual trust and appreciation grow over the course of the endeavor.
